vi /usr/bin/lolcat
#!/bin/sh
awk ‘{
srand();
for (i = 1; i <= length($0); i++) {
c = substr($0, i, 1);
color = int(rand() * 256);
printf “\033[38;5;%dm%c\033[0m”, color, c;
}
print “”;
}’
chmod 777
fortune | cowsay | lolcat # 直接输出彩虹效果
张小明
前端开发工程师
vi /usr/bin/lolcat
#!/bin/sh
awk ‘{
srand();
for (i = 1; i <= length($0); i++) {
c = substr($0, i, 1);
color = int(rand() * 256);
printf “\033[38;5;%dm%c\033[0m”, color, c;
}
print “”;
}’
chmod 777
fortune | cowsay | lolcat # 直接输出彩虹效果
工业级串口接收的终极方案:用HAL_UARTEx_ReceiveToIdle_DMA彻底告别丢包与高CPU占用你有没有遇到过这样的场景?你的STM32正在跑Modbus RTU协议,突然某个读取指令没响应;传感器以115200波特率连续发数据,主控偶尔“吃掉…
前言 安装Python和Zotero;安装uv或者conda二选一,我安装的是conda 建议下载3.12.0版本Python 插件目前支持Zotero 7以及Zotero 8 第一步:安装uv/conda 1.安装uv: # 方法一: 下载脚本安装(推荐) # macOS/Linux wget -qO- htt…
目录已开发项目效果实现截图开发技术路线相关技术介绍核心代码参考示例结论源码lw获取/同行可拿货,招校园代理 :文章底部获取博主联系方式!已开发项目效果实现截图 同行可拿货,招校园代理 python小程序 公安基层民警心理数字画像与救助平台 _03zips22…
51单片机最小系统中LED指示灯的设计要点从“点亮第一盏灯”说起:为什么我们要认真对待这个最简单的外设?在嵌入式开发的世界里,“点亮一个LED”常被戏称为程序员的“Hello World”。但别小看这盏小小的灯——它不只是教学演示中的点缀&#x…
“could not find driver”深度解析:从数据库到内核模块的全链路排错指南你有没有在深夜调试一个看似简单的服务时,突然被一条错误拦住去路——“could not find driver”?它不痛不痒,只一句话,却足以让整个应用启动失…
💡实话实说:CSDN上做毕设辅导的都是专业技术服务,大家都要生活,这个很正常。我和其他人不同的是,我有自己的项目库存,不需要找别人拿货再加价,所以能给到超低价格。摘要 随着信息技术的飞速发展…